    Default Can separately-created lines be joined or grouped, then filled?

    Hi Forumites,

    I design digital art using Photo & Graphic Designer (love it to pieces!). I'll design, say, half a heart, copy, paste, reverse it and put the pieces together. Is there a way to then fill it, or must it be one continuous line with touching ends to be able to fill it?

    I know it wasn't before, but wondering if the newest version has that feature.

    Default Re: Can separately-created lines be joined or grouped, then filled?

    I use XDP, but I would imagine it works the same in your version.

    I drag out a ruler guide and align the two end nodes to it.
    Then I duplicate the half, flip it vertically and align it to the ruler guide against the other half.

    Then I use the Shape Tool to drag one of the nodes a little bit away, then back again and you should see a little 'plus' symbol indicating it is going to join the node being dragged back into position and connect it to the other half's corresponding node.

    Then do the other end and it likely will automatically fill.
